Athletistic / Tennis. Russian tennis player Alina Korneeva has commented on not taking part in the US Open. The 16-year-old Russian was able to participate in the tournament qualifier, but refused to travel because she wouldn’t have time to get a US visa.

“We thought that if I won Wimbledon junior, we would play the US Open – because it would be a possible fourth Slam. But it didn’t work out and we decided we didn’t need to go anymore. And after the victorious “weaving”, it was too late to apply. Even when I played “Sotka”, I did not think I could qualify. I was told this after the awards in Portugal.
